Question:
Let $P$ be any point on $x-y+3=0$ and $A=(3,4)$. If the family of lines $(3\sec\theta+5\csc\theta)x+(7\sec\theta-3\csc\theta)y+11(\sec\theta-\csc\theta)=0$ are concurrent at $B$ for all permissible $\theta$, then max value of $|PA-PB|$ is
(A) 3
(B) $2\sqrt{10}$
(C) $2\sqrt{34}$
(D) 5
Step-by-Step Solution
Key Concept: Find $B$ by solving two linearly independent equations from the family. $|PA-PB|\leq|AB|$ with max at collinear config.
Max $|PA-PB|=2\sqrt{10}$.
Correct Answer: (B) $2\sqrt{10}$
